Advanced Autonomous Agents: Beyond Basic Chatbots
Autonomous agents represent the next evolution in AI-powered business automation. Unlike reactive chatbots that wait for user input, autonomous agents can proactively monitor conditions, trigger actions based on events, and execute multi-step workflows independently. How do autonomous agents differ from standard Copilot Studio agents?
Standard agents respond to user messages in a conversation. Autonomous agents can initiate actions based on events, run on schedules, and execute multi-step workflows without continuous user interaction. They represent a more advanced level of automation.
What enterprise scenarios benefit most from autonomous agents?
Common high-value scenarios include automated customer communications, proactive IT monitoring and remediation, compliance checking, document processing workflows, and intelligent request routing. Any repetitive multi-step process is a candidate for autonomous agent automation.
How do you ensure autonomous agents do not take unintended actions?
The training covers guardrails including action approval workflows, scope limitations, audit logging, and human-in-the-loop escalation paths. Proper governance ensures agents operate safely within defined boundaries.
